Company Overview: uniQure N.V. (NASDAQ: QURE) is a Dutch biopharma specializing in gene therapies (en.wikipedia.org). It developed Hemgenix (etranacogene dezaparvovec) for hemophilia B – approved by the FDA in 2022 as the first gene therapy for that disease (en.wikipedia.org). Hemgenix is licensed to CSL Behring, who priced it at $3.5 million per dose, making it the world’s most expensive therapy (www.axios.com). Aside from Hemgenix (now generating modest royalties), QURE’s value is driven by its pipeline: notably AMT-130, a one-time AAV gene therapy for Huntington’s disease, and earlier-stage programs for Fabry disease (AMT-191), temporal lobe epilepsy (AMT-260), and ALS (AMT-162). Dividend Policy & Yield
QURE does not pay any dividend, which is typical for development-stage biotechs. Management has never declared cash dividends and does not anticipate doing so in the foreseeable future, preferring to reinvest any future earnings into growth (www.sec.gov). As of today the dividend yield stands at 0%, and shareholders should expect returns only through stock price appreciation (www.sec.gov) (www.sec.gov). In fact, the company explicitly notes that even if it achieves significant profits later, it would hold off on dividends until it has a sustained revenue stream and sufficient equity under Dutch law (www.sec.gov). Thus, income investors should look elsewhere; QURE is purely a growth/pharma R&D play.
Leverage & Debt Maturities
Despite heavy R&D spending, QURE has managed its balance sheet conservatively, especially after monetizing a portion of Hemgenix royalties. The company carries a venture debt facility with Hercules Capital, amended in 2025 to allow borrowings up to $175 million (www.sec.gov). As of YE 2025, QURE had drawn $50 million on this loan, with no principal due until October 2028 and final maturity in October 2030 (www.sec.gov) (www.sec.gov). The interest rate is floating (prime + 2.45%, floored at 9.45%) (www.sec.gov), implying a relatively high cash interest cost (~9.5%). However, the company proactively repaid $50 million of prior Hercules debt in mid-2024 (www.sec.gov), reducing interest expense. No other significant term debt is on the books, and there are no near-term maturities – the Hercules loan is interest-only for nearly three more years (www.sec.gov).

Notably, QURE in 2023 entered a Royalty Financing Agreement, selling rights to the lowest tier of Hemgenix royalties for a $375 million upfront payment (www.sec.gov). This effectively acts as non-recourse debt: the investor will receive a portion of Hemgenix sales until a cap is reached, after which the royalty reverts to QURE (www.sec.gov). On QURE’s balance sheet, the transaction is accounted for as a $473 million liability at 2025’s fair value (www.sec.gov) (www.sec.gov). There are no cash interest payments here – instead, the liability amortizes as the investor collects royalties. In practice, this gave QURE a huge cash infusion in 2023 (net $370.1 million after fees) (www.sec.gov), bolstering liquidity at the cost of forgoing some future Hemgenix revenue.
Leverage: Including the royalty obligation, QURE’s total debt accounting is substantial, but traditional net debt is negative due to a large cash pile. The debt-to-capital ratio is modest – shareholders’ equity swung from a slight deficit in 2024 to $199 million positive in 2025 after equity raises (www.sec.gov). The Hercules loan is secured by substantially all assets (www.sec.gov), but QURE’s low gearing and high cash levels mitigate default risk. Overall, the company has ample liquidity and low near-term leverage pressure, positioning it to fund ongoing trials.

Coverage and Cash Flow
With no earnings and ongoing losses, QURE’s interest coverage on a GAAP basis is negative. In 2025 the company had a net loss of $199 million (www.sec.gov), so EBIT was far below zero – meaning operating cash flow does not cover fixed charges. However, QURE can comfortably pay its obligations from its cash reserves. As of Dec 31, 2025, the company held $622.5 million in cash, equivalents and investments (www.sec.gov) – enough to fund operations into the second half of 2029 by management’s estimates (www.sec.gov) (www.sec.gov). This runway includes covering interest costs. In fact, QURE earned $17.0 million of interest income on its cash in 2025 (www.sec.gov), which actually exceeded the $6.9 million cash interest expense on its Hercules debt that year (www.sec.gov). Even when adding in the non-cash interest accretion on the royalty liability (~$54 million in 2025) (www.sec.gov), the company’s net interest burden remains manageable due to the lack of near-term payables.
Crucially, QURE’s core cash burn is its R&D and overhead. Operating cash flow was –$178 million in 2025 (www.sec.gov), reflecting heavy clinical development spend. That burn rate will likely rise as it launches a new Phase III trial (discussed below). But given the war chest from royalty monetization and a follow-on equity offering, QURE can sustain its R&D without needing to tap debt or equity markets for a few years. Interest coverage ratios are therefore less relevant — the company’s solvency rests on its ability to advance pipeline programs before the cash runs out in ~2029.
Valuation and Comps
Traditional valuation metrics paint QURE as extremely expensive, which is typical for biotech firms with thin revenues. Trailing revenues were only $16.1 million in 2025 (www.sec.gov) (mostly milestone/license revenue), against a market capitalization in the billions. For example, after positive Huntington’s data in late 2025, QURE’s market cap surged to ~$2.76 billion (www.kiplinger.com). This implies price-to-sales multiples in the hundreds, and P/E is not meaningful due to net losses. Even on a balance sheet basis, QURE trades at a hefty premium: price-to-book was over 13× at year-end 2025 (market cap ~$2.8B vs equity ~$199M) (www.kiplinger.com) (www.sec.gov). Clearly, investors are valuing QURE on anticipated future cash flows from its pipeline rather than current fundamentals.
A more appropriate lens is biotech comparables and pipeline NPV. QURE’s valuation soared in anticipation that AMT-130 for Huntington’s could be a blockbuster one-time treatment. The 247% share jump on Sept 24, 2025 (www.kiplinger.com) underscores how clinical trial success can dramatically reprice such stocks. At ~$2–3 billion valuation, QURE is being benchmarked against other gene therapy developers with late-stage assets. For instance, companies pursuing CNS gene therapies or rare disease cures often see multi-billion caps when data is favorable – even if they have no approved products. In QURE’s case, one could argue the enterprise value (EV) (market cap minus net cash) of roughly ~$2.2B reflects the risk-adjusted present value of AMT-130 plus the Fabry and other programs. EV/Revenue is not meaningful currently (over 100×). Instead, investors look at factors like: potential patient population and pricing of Huntington’s therapy, probability of approval, time to market, and royalty streams from Hemgenix. By those measures, QURE’s valuation is optimistic but was justified by breakthrough clinical data – until the recent FDA twist which likely trimmed some of that optimism.
In comparison, larger gene therapy players (e.g. Sarepta, which markets a DMD gene therapy) trade at more moderate multiples of actual product sales, but they also have revenue. QURE is still pre-commercial (its Hemgenix royalties were largely sold off and anyway small to date), so its valuation is essentially a bet on R&D success. Investors should be aware that such valuations can swing wildly on regulatory news – as we just saw.
FDA Rebuke and Key Development Update
The impetus for this alert was a significant regulatory development regarding QURE’s lead program AMT-130. In late 2025, uniQure announced that the FDA “moved the goalposts” for Huntington’s – reversing prior guidance about a faster approval path (apnews.com). QURE’s Phase I/II study of AMT-130 had delivered impressive results: a 75% slowing of disease progression at 36 months for high-dose patients, relative to matched controls (www.sec.gov). This first-in-human gene therapy for Huntington’s showed a clear biomarker effect (reducing CSF NfL, a marker of neurodegeneration) and was generally well-tolerated (www.sec.gov) (www.sec.gov). Off these data, the FDA granted Breakthrough Therapy designation in April 2025 (www.sec.gov), and QURE hoped to file for accelerated approval using the Phase I/II results and an external control comparison.
However, at a pre-BLA meeting in October 2025, and confirmed in final meeting minutes by March 2026, the FDA refused to accept the single-arm data as sufficient (www.sec.gov) (www.sec.gov). Regulators “cannot agree” that the Phase I/II results (compared against an external natural history control) provide adequate evidence for a BLA application (www.sec.gov). The agency “strongly recommended” that QURE conduct a new prospective, randomized, sham-controlled trial of AMT-130 (www.sec.gov). In other words, the FDA is rebuking the idea of approving the therapy early on a surrogate endpoint; instead QURE must run a proper Phase III with a placebo (sham surgery) control. This was a sharp reversal from earlier indications that an accelerated path might be feasible (apnews.com). The news has been echoed in critical commentary – e.g. The Wall Street Journal highlighted QURE’s case as an example of FDA’s inconsistent standards stalling breakthroughs (apnews.com).
For QURE, this development is pivotal. It delays potential approval by likely several years, increases R&D cost, and adds uncertainty (a larger trial must confirm efficacy). The Huntington’s program went from a near-term catalyst (possible filing in 2024–25) to a longer-term project. Investor sentiment has soured accordingly – the stock, which soared on the Phase I/II data, has retraced some gains as the regulatory risk materialized. QURE’s management now faces the task of launching a Phase III trial with perhaps hundreds of patients globally, including a sham brain surgery control. Such trials are complex and will likely run into 2027+ for completion. The FDA’s stance also suggests a higher efficacy bar: QURE may need to show unequivocal clinical benefit (not just biomarker changes) to secure approval.
This FDA rebuke sparks critical questions about QURE’s timeline and strategy (see Open Questions below). It also casts a shadow on valuation – much of QURE’s ~$2B+ market cap was predicated on AMT-130’s accelerated approval prospects. Now, the pathway is more traditional. On the flip side, getting FDA clarity now, rather than a surprise rejection later, might save QURE from a failed filing. The company can design the Phase III to meet the stricter requirements. Importantly, QURE has the cash to carry out the new trial without immediate financing needs, thanks to its recent fundraising. The situation underscores the regulatory risk inherent in gene therapy: agencies are cautious, especially after some high-profile safety issues in the field, and even Breakthrough designation is no guarantee of leniency.
Risks and Red Flags
Regulatory uncertainty is the top risk illustrated here. The FDA’s shifting stance on AMT-130 shows how approval goalposts can move (apnews.com). QURE invested years in a program under one set of expectations, only to have the agency demand more. This could delay revenue (if any) by years. Moreover, global regulators might have different views – it’s unclear if Europe’s EMA might consider conditional approval on the existing data or will also insist on a new trial. Investors should brace for protracted regulatory interactions.
Clinical and safety risks remain significant. Gene therapies carry known dangers (immune reactions, liver toxicity, etc.), and competitors’ experiences are cautionary. For example, in mid-2025, Sarepta Therapeutics faced FDA intervention after three patient deaths on its gene therapy – its stock plunged ~42% on news of a second death (apnews.com). While QURE’s trials have not seen such severe outcomes, there have been red flags. In its Fabry disease program (AMT-191), two patients in a mid-dose cohort developed asymptomatic Grade 3 liver enzyme elevations, which were deemed dose-limiting toxicities (www.sec.gov). As a result, QURE had to halt dosing of new patients at high and low doses pending investigation (www.sec.gov). This kind of safety signal, even if manageable, can lead to trial pauses or modifications. Any serious adverse event in the upcoming larger Huntington’s trial (e.g. from brain surgery delivery of the vector) could trigger an FDA clinical hold. QURE’s own filings acknowledge that setbacks or holds could occur at any time (www.sec.gov) (www.sec.gov). Overall, the safety/efficacy profile of these experimental therapies is not fully established – a key risk to eventual approval and adoption.
High cash burn and dependency on financing: QURE will likely remain deeply unprofitable for years. Annual net losses have ranged from ~$199–308 million in the past three years (www.sec.gov) (www.sec.gov) and could increase with a Phase III trial underway. While the company currently has a large cash cushion, cost overruns or extended timelines could bring financing needs back on the table around 2027 or earlier if new programs advance aggressively. The dilution risk is real – QURE issued ~$380 million of new shares in late 2025’s follow-on offering (www.sec.gov) (www.sec.gov) (diluting existing holders, though at a strong price). Future equity raises cannot be ruled out if the Huntington’s trial or other studies slip.
Limited revenue and royalty constraints: QURE’s only potential near-term revenue source is royalties from Hemgenix, and those are partly signed away. The royalty financing deal gave QURE cash up front but means the first chunk of Hemgenix sales won’t benefit the company (www.sec.gov) (www.sec.gov). If Hemgenix commercial uptake remains slow (which is possible given the $3.5 M price and the ultra-rare patient pool), the investor who bought the royalties might never hit their cap – in which case QURE would not see any additional royalty income beyond what’s already been paid. Even if sales grow, QURE only retains higher-tier royalties (after the lowest tier diverted) and potentially milestone payments. So the upside from Hemgenix is limited in the near term. Additionally, CSL Behring signaled plans to move manufacturing to another CMO by 2023–2024 (www.sec.gov), potentially reducing QURE’s role (and any manufacturing fees it earned). Any hiccup in Hemgenix production or commercial execution by CSL could reflect poorly on QURE’s reputation and small remaining revenue.
Manufacturing and partner reliance: QURE undertook a major restructuring in 2024 by selling its Lexington manufacturing facility to Genezen, thereby outsourcing all production (www.sec.gov). While this cut costs (QURE reduced ~65% of its workforce with that deal) (www.sec.gov), it introduces third-party risk. Genezen is now responsible for manufacturing Hemgenix for CSL and supplying QURE’s trial material (www.sec.gov) (www.sec.gov). If Genezen fails to meet quality or capacity demands, QURE could breach its obligations to CSL or face trial delays (www.sec.gov) (www.sec.gov). QURE does hold a stake in Genezen (including a $12.5 M convertible note and equity with an 8% dividend) as part of the sale, aligning incentives (www.sec.gov) (www.sec.gov). But ultimately QURE is dependent on partners – CSL for Hemgenix’s commercialization, and Genezen for manufacturing. These dependencies could become red flags if, for example, CSL’s priorities change or if Genezen encounters production issues (e.g. an FDA compliance problem at the site). Any such events would directly hit QURE’s pipeline progress or economics.
Competitive landscape: While QURE is a leader in Huntington’s gene therapy (no direct competitors in clinical trials yet, as its approach is first-of-kind), there are alternative therapeutic strategies in development. Large pharma and biotech firms are pursuing ASO (antisense) or siRNA treatments for Huntington’s (e.g. Wave Life Sciences, Roche/Ionis had tominersen, etc.), though past trials were mixed. It’s a risk that a different modality could succeed or that QURE’s approach might face competition by the time it’s ready to market. In Fabry disease, competition is already fierce: other gene therapies (4D Molecular Therapeutics, Freeline) and new enzyme replacement or substrate reduction therapies are in development. If a competitor shows superior efficacy or gets to market first, QURE’s Fabry program could struggle. The gene therapy field in general is seeing rapid innovation – for example, CRISPR-based therapies (like Vertex/CRISPR’s exa-cel for hemoglobin disorders) are emerging. QURE must continue to innovate (e.g. novel AAV capsids, improved delivery techniques (www.sec.gov) (www.sec.gov)) to stay ahead. Any patent or IP issues could also be a risk – QURE licenses certain vector technologies (e.g. AAV9 license from Regenxbio for AMT-260) and pays royalties (www.sec.gov) (www.sec.gov). If these arrangements become disputatious or if it lost access, that could hinder development.
In summary, QURE faces the typical binary risks of a late-stage biotech: heavy reliance on one major program, regulatory hurdles, high burn, and external dependencies. The recent FDA setback is a stark reminder that success is not just about clinical data but also aligning with regulators’ evolving standards.
Open Questions and Outlook
Will QURE find a partner for the Phase III Huntington’s trial? The requirement for a new sham-controlled study raises the scale and cost significantly. QURE might seek a large pharmaceutical partner to co-develop or co-fund AMT-130 through Phase III and commercialization. A partnership (or even sale of the company) could de-risk the financing and bring expertise (for example, large neuro-oriented companies might be interested). Conversely, QURE might try to go it alone, given its cash reserves. How it proceeds could impact shareholders – a partnership might involve giving up some equity in the asset (or company) but would validate the technology. This remains an open strategic question.
What is the timeline to approval now? Investors are left guessing when (or if) AMT-130 will reach the market. If QURE can initiate the Phase III in 2024, enrollment might take 1–2 years (Huntington’s is rare but there is a motivated patient community). Outcome measures (clinical progression, functional scales) might need 12–18 months follow-up. Thus, primary data could arrive ~2027, meaning approval in 2028 at best – a 3+ year delay versus the accelerated approval hope. Could any intermediate analysis or surrogate endpoints allow for an earlier filing? Unlikely, given FDA’s stance. European regulators could potentially entertain a conditional approval if data remain robust, but that’s speculative. This timeline essentially means QURE will have no product revenue for the rest of the decade, raising the importance of careful cash management and/or interim partnerships.
Will the FDA change its position if the disease is severe with no alternatives? The FDA has been facing criticism for rejecting rare disease drugs despite unmet needs (www.axios.com). Huntington’s has zero approved disease-modifying therapies. QURE and patient advocates may continue to push the agency on flexibility. Is there a chance that exceptional results in an expanded patient set could still lead to an early filing or accelerated nod? Or could Congress/advocacy pressure alter the regulatory path? As of now, the FDA’s feedback is quite firm (www.sec.gov) (www.sec.gov). This question ties into the broader debate on how stringent the FDA should be for dire diseases. It will be worth watching if any middle ground (such as Phase III interim data approval with post-marketing confirmatory requirements) becomes feasible.
How much real-world usage will Hemgenix achieve, and does QURE benefit? Hemgenix’s commercial trajectory is still an open question. Being priced at $3.5 million, uptake may be slow as payers evaluate long-term cost offsets (e.g. eliminating lifelong factor IX infusions) (www.axios.com). If only a small number of hemophilia B patients opt for gene therapy annually, CSL’s sales might be modest. QURE has already monetized the first slice of those royalties, but if sales explode beyond expectations, QURE could start receiving the upper-tier royalties or benefit if the royalty buyout cap is hit. Conversely, if uptake is tepid, the $370 M QURE received may end up being more than it would ever have earned from royalties – but that also means no steady royalty stream in future. This trade-off’s outcome will unfold over years. Investors should monitor CSL Behring’s commentary on Hemgenix adoption and any competitor advances (like Pfizer’s hemophilia B gene therapy or alternative treatments). A related question: could CSL Behring acquire QURE outright? CSL has a vested interest in Hemgenix and a relationship with QURE; if QURE’s valuation comes down, CSL or another pharma might see an opportunity to buy the pipeline (including the Huntington’s program) on the cheap.
Can QURE advance its other pipeline candidates to diversify risk? The company is not a one-trick pony scientifically – it has AMT-191 for Fabry in Phase I/II and plans IND-stage programs like AMT-260 (epilepsy) and AMT-162 (ALS) (www.sec.gov) (www.sec.gov). These represent additional shots on goal. An open question is whether any of these will produce meaningful data in the next 1–2 years that could generate investor excitement or partnering deals. For instance, can AMT-191 show clear efficacy in Fabry patients (e.g. reduction in globotriaosylceramide substrate or improvement in kidney/cardiac function)? Early data have been mixed, with safety issues at higher doses (www.sec.gov) – will QURE be able to resolve dosing and demonstrate a compelling risk/benefit? Similarly, AMT-260 for refractory epilepsy (acquired via Corlieve in 2021) is still preclinical; a question is whether it will enter the clinic soon and how it stacks up against other approaches (there’s intense interest in gene therapy for focal epilepsy). Any positive developments in these programs could catalyze the stock and reduce the overreliance on AMT-130. On the other hand, setbacks (like if Fabry program is discontinued due to toxicity) would increase QURE’s concentration risk. Management has indicated it will advance these candidates to proof-of-concept “as a priority” (www.biospace.com) – execution here will be important to watch.
Will uniQure become an M&A target? Given the M&A trend in gene therapy (Spark Therapeutics was snapped up by Roche in 2019 (www.axios.com); more recently, Pfizer acquired Biohaven’s gene therapy portfolio, etc.), QURE’s technology and pipeline could attract suitors. The stock’s volatility and the recent FDA delay may actually make it more attractive to a long-term pharma buyer who is less concerned about a 2–3 year delay. QURE’s miQURE gene-silencing platform, AAV manufacturing know-how, and proven ability to get a product approved are valuable assets. A larger company could integrate QURE’s pipeline and navigate the Phase III with its resources. The open question for investors is whether QURE will remain independent through the completion of the Huntington’s trial – or if a partnership or buyout will occur before then. No rumors are evident yet, but this scenario is worth considering, especially if the share price remains depressed relative to its peak.
